SURROUNDINGS

VERONA

Corte Palazzo Rosso B&B is situated in the tranquility of the village of Grezzana but only a few minutes drive from Verona.

In Verona, everything is history. The historic center of Verona is particularly fascinating and impressive. If you walk around the streets and squares, you can discover many architectural and artistic beauties: the mighty Verona Arena and Piazza Bra, the romantic balcony of Romeo and Juliet, the colorful and traditional market stalls in Piazza delle Erbe, the hills of Torricelle where you have a magnificent view of Verona.

LAKE GARDA

Verona and its surroundings are known for the many beautiful shores of Lake Garda towns that attract countless visitors every season with their beautiful landscape. Lake Garda, is the biggest lake in Italy. Its landscape is dominated by rugged mountain ranges in the north and flat soft hills in the south.
The picturesque villages of Lake Garda can be easily reached by car or by boat. A boat trip offers the possibility to enjoy a different view of the lakeshore and to discover ancient villas which are otherwise hidden from curious eyes with huge parks on the landside.

VALPANTENA

B&B Corte Palazzo Rosso is located in Grezzana, Valpantena.
The name Valpantena originates from the word ‘Pantheon’, Roman temple, which is located in Santa Maria in Stelle (the temple has a painted ceiling that resembles the night sky).

The Valpantena is part of the Valpolicella wine area, where renowned wines such as Valpolicella, Amarone and Recioto are locally produced.

The Valpantena offers opportunities for horse riding, cycling (mountain bike or road bike) or hiking on the many walking paths, such as the European route E5 (from Lake Constance to Verona) which passes on in about 20 minutes walking distance from our house.
